These problems can be defined as a set of partial differential equations that are to be solved for a domain whose boundaries are not known a priori but have to be determined as an integral part of the solution. Ion transport number, also called the transference number, is the fraction of the total electrical current carried in an electrolyte by a given ionic species, differences in transport number arise from differences in electrical mobility. Tiselius was awarded the 1948 nobel prize in chemistry for his work on the separation of colloids through electrophoresis, the motion of charged particles through a stationary liquid under the influence of an electric field. A comprehensive account of the mathematical formulation of problems involving free boundaries occurring in hydrology, metallurgy, chemical engineering, soil science, molecular biology, materials science, and steel and glass production, this book discusses new methods of solution including modern computer techniques.
